The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 93117 zip code. The total population is 54915, of which, 27789 are male and 27126 are female. With a total area of 440.527 square miles, the population density is 132.9 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 22.9 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ics
The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 93117 zip code is $117624. This is 11.99% greater than the national average. This income places 27.8%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$44237. Education
In the 93117 zip code, 87.9%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 49.5%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ics
In the 93117 zip, there are an estimated 30727 people in the labor force, of which, 27981 are employed, and 2737 are unemployed. There are a total of 9 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 17 minutes. Of the total people that work, 2893 worked from home and 26925 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 31.3. Housing
The median home value for the 93117 zip code is 838300. There is an estimated 16458 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1861 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1907.
